目的:本研究旨在探討不同人口統計變項對運動心理堅韌性的知覺差異比較;不同人口統計變項在主觀幸福感的知覺差異比較;同時探討運動心理堅韌性對主觀幸福感之預測效果。方法:以立意取樣,針對報名參加由交通大學舉辦2011年全國大專羽球錦標賽之男女參賽選手為研究對象,依照大會參賽人員之統計,共發出300份問卷,剔除無效問卷,共回收217份問卷,回收率達71%;以多變量統計檢驗其差異性;以多元逐步回歸,檢測其預測能力。結果:不同性別、學歷、運動成績在運動心理堅韌性有顯著差異性存在;不同地區學生在主觀幸福感有顯著差異性存在;運動心理堅韌性以「積極奮鬥」對主觀幸福感預測能力最佳。結論:當大學羽球選手為了追求其目標所展現的心理堅韌性越高,其幸福感受也越高。
Purpose: This research aimed to discuss perception difference between the different population statistic variables on sport mental toughness and subjective well-being, as well as the prediction effectiveness of sport mental toughness on subjective well-being. Method: The subjects were the male and female participants of the 2010 National college badminton championships, held by the National Chiao-Tung University. According to the committee, 300 questionnaires were sent totally. After excluding invalid ones, 217 of them were retrieved, which made the recovery rate up to 71%. The perception difference was verified via multivariable analysis, while the predictability was by multiple stepwise regressions. Results: There was a significant diversity on sport mental toughness between different gender, academic background and athletic achievements, and the difference of subjective well-being between students from different regions was noticeable as well. Above all, ”positive struggle” in sport mental toughness had the best predictability to subjective well-being. Conclusion: The badminton players in university would experience much more happiness when they expressed higher mental toughness to pursue their goals.
